Grave marker for Maud Francis nee Jones (1880-1929) includes a sculpture of a classical maiden in flowing gown, holding lilies in her clasped hands. She stands sideways before a granite marker with rough edges.

Young woman with long flowing hair with closed eyes. Her hands are clasp in front of her and some long stemmed flowers rest against her right shoulder. Her left foot rests on the edge of the memorial.
TITLE: Maud Francis Grave Marker
ARTIST(S): Elizabet Ney (possibly by)
DATE: None given
MEDIUM: Maiden: marble; Base: granite.
CONTROL NUMBER: IAS TX000795
Direct Link to the Individual Listing in the Smithsonian Art Inventory: [Web Link]
PHYSICAL LOCATION: In Crosby Cemetery
545 Texas 29
Mason, TX 76856
DIFFERENCES NOTED BETWEEN THE INVENTORY LISTING AND YOUR OBSERVATIONS AND RESEARCH: The Urn shown in the Smithsonian pictures is gone.
